How to Export Tax Summary from Shopify (2026 Guide)
Follow these steps to export your Shopify tax summary as a CSV file. Once exported, you can use our converter to transform the data for your target system.
Export Steps
1
Export from Shopify
Analytics → Reports → Taxes → Export CSV
Required Tax Summary Fields
| Field | Type | Description | Example |
|---|---|---|---|
| Period Start | Date | Report period start date | 2025-01-01 |
| Period End | Date | Report period end date | 2025-01-31 |
| Tax Jurisdiction | Text | Tax authority name (State, Province, Country) | California |
| Taxable Sales | Currency | Total taxable sales amount | 10000.00 |
| Tax Collected | Currency | Sales tax collected from customers | 725.00 |
Your Shopify export must include these fields for successful conversion.
